Understanding Crypto Real Estate

To grasp the significance of Vietnam crypto real estate for hospitality sector, we must first understand what crypto real estate entails. In essence, crypto real estate refers to properties that are sold, leased, or managed using cryptocurrencies and blockchain technology. This method increases transaction security, speeds up the buying and selling process, and ensures transparency—a key factor for attracting foreign investments.

Consider this: just like a bank vault provides secure storage for cash, blockchain secures digital transactions, thus resolving many conventional real estate issues such as title fraud or transaction disputes.

Advantages of Using Crypto in Real Estate Transactions

  • Enhanced Security: Blockchain technology allows for highly secure transactions with minimal risk of fraud.
  • Faster Transactions: Traditional real estate transactions can take weeks to finalize. Crypto transactions can be executed in a matter of hours.
  • Transparency: All transactions on the blockchain are visible and traceable, ensuring a higher level of trust.
  • International Accessibility: Crypto can facilitate cross-border transactions without the hassle of currency conversions.

The Role of Blockchain in Vietnam’s Hospitality Sector

The hospitality sector can leverage blockchain not only for transactions but also for customer relationship management, supply chain logistics, and property management. A recent report by Deloitte indicated that integrating blockchain into hospitality can reduce operational costs by up to 30%.

For instance, a hotel chain can utilize smart contracts to automate booking and payment systems. Imagine a world where guests can book a room directly with cryptocurrency, and upon payment, the smart contract automatically processes the transaction without delays.

Key Challenges to Consider

While opportunities abound, several challenges persist in adopting crypto real estate in the hospitality sector, such as:

  • Regulatory Framework: The Vietnamese government is still defining regulations surrounding cryptocurrencies. Understanding these laws is imperative for compliance.
  • Market Education: Many investors and stakeholders are still unfamiliar with blockchain technology and its advantages.
  • Volatility: Cryptocurrencies can be volatile, which may impact the real estate market by creating uncertainty.
